Real world asset (RWA) tokenization is one of the most promising frontiers in crypto — but most protocols fail at the first impression. The challenge: design landing pages that make abstract, institutional-grade financial primitives feel tangible, trustworthy, and alive.

Setting the Scene

The Solana Foundation was exploring how to present an institutional-grade RWA protocol — one that tokenizes US Treasuries, real estate, private credit, and commodities on-chain, audited daily and settled in seconds. The goal wasn't a single landing page; it was three distinct visual and interaction directions, each exploring a different way to communicate trust, scale, and yield to institutional and retail audiences alike.

The Problem

RWA protocols face a unique design problem. The audience spans institutional investors who need hard data and audit trails, and retail users who need to understand what 'tokenized real world assets' even means. Most existing RWA landing pages either buried the value proposition under jargon or leaned so hard into hype that they undermined the institutional credibility the product depended on. The protocol needed landing pages that could speak to both audiences without compromising either.

What made it hard

  • Communicating institutional trust (audits, custody, jurisdictions) without making the page feel like a compliance document
  • Making abstract concepts — TVL, tokenomics, asset backing — visually tangible and interactive rather than static numbers
  • Designing data-dense dashboards (network topology, donut charts, unlock timelines) that remained responsive and legible on mobile
  • Differentiating three concepts enough to be genuinely useful as design exploration, while keeping a consistent brand language
  • Balancing real-time data visualization with the performance constraints of a marketing landing page

The landing page for an RWA protocol isn't a marketing surface — it's a trust interface. Every chart, metric, and visualization has to double as proof that the protocol is real, audited, and operating.

What the Research Revealed

  • Institutional audiences scanned for specific trust signals first — audit frequency, custodian names, jurisdiction count, TVL — before reading any narrative copy
  • Retail users needed an emotional entry point ('own a piece of the real economy') before they were willing to engage with the data
  • Interactive data visualizations (network graphs, donut charts with hover states) dramatically increased time-on-page compared to static metric cards
  • Real-time-feeling elements — live tickers, animated charts, 'all systems operational' status — were the single biggest driver of perceived legitimacy
  • Three distinct hero treatments tested better than any single 'optimized' hero, because different audience segments responded to different framings of the same value prop

The Approach

I designed three fully responsive, interactive landing page concepts — each with a distinct hero treatment, data visualization language, and information architecture, but all sharing the same underlying RWA protocol story. Concept One leads with a two-column hero and a live asset network node graph. Concept Two centers on a bold 'World's Assets, On-Chain' statement with a tokenized asset marketplace. Concept Three opens with 'Own the Future of Real World Assets' and the NEXUS network topology. Across all three, I built interactive dashboards — global market overview, protocol performance, tokenomics distribution, and diversified portfolio breakdown — that made the protocol's scale and trust tangible.

Three concepts, one protocol

Rather than iterating toward a single 'best' landing page, I designed three complete, shippable concepts — each exploring a different emotional entry point (trust, scale, ownership) so stakeholders could compare directions side by side.

Data visualization as trust signal

Every concept features interactive charts — network topologies, donut allocations, unlock timelines, performance graphs — that double as proof of the protocol's legitimacy. The data isn't decoration; it's the argument.

Live-feeling elements throughout

Real-time tickers, animated metric counters, 'all systems operational' status indicators, and hover-responsive charts create a sense that the protocol is actively running — critical for a category where trust is everything.

Responsive data density

Dashboards with network graphs, multi-segment donuts, and bar chart timelines were designed mobile-first — collapsing gracefully into stacked layouts without losing legibility or interactivity.

Consistent tokenomics language

All three concepts share a unified visual language for NXR token distribution, vesting timelines, and governance metrics — so the protocol's economics read consistently regardless of which hero a visitor lands on.

Beyond the Numbers

  • Designing for RWA taught me that in trust-critical categories, the data visualization IS the marketing — a well-designed chart communicates more legitimacy than any headline
  • Building three full concepts instead of one 'optimized' page was the right call — it gave stakeholders a genuine comparison and surfaced which emotional framings resonated with which audiences
  • The network topology visualizations were the most rewarding challenge — making a complex graph of custodians, assets, and liquidity protocols feel intuitive and beautiful on both desktop and mobile
  • Tokenomics design revealed how much UX work goes into making vesting schedules and supply breakdowns feel transparent rather than intimidating

What I Took Away

This project reinforced that in emerging crypto categories — especially institutional ones — the landing page is the product's credibility. You're not designing a funnel; you're designing a trust interface where every interactive element has to earn its place.

  • In trust-critical categories, interactive data visualization beats copy every time — show the protocol working, don't just describe it
  • Designing multiple complete concepts is more valuable than iterating one — comparison surfaces truths that optimization hides
  • Real-time-feeling UI elements (tickers, live status, animated counters) are disproportionately powerful for perceived legitimacy in crypto
  • Responsive data density is a solvable design problem — network graphs and multi-segment charts can collapse to mobile without losing meaning if architected intentionally
